How Hackers Can Get into Your WiFi Router
WiFi routers are essentially the gatekeepers of your home network, controlling who can access the internet and what devices can connect. However, like any other device, they can be vulnerable to hacking. Here are some common ways hackers can gain access to your WiFi router:
Weak Passwords and Authentication
One of the most common methods hackers use to gain access to WiFi routers is by exploiting weak passwords and authentication protocols. Many users fail to change the default admin password, leaving their router open to attack. Even if you have changed the password, using a weak or easily guessable password can still put your router at risk.
Default Passwords
Default passwords are often easily available online, making it simple for hackers to gain access to your router. It’s essential to change the default password to a strong, unique one to prevent unauthorized access.
Weak Passwords
Using weak passwords, such as those that are easily guessable or contain common patterns, can also put your router at risk. Hackers use specialized software to crack weak passwords, gaining access to your router and network.
Outdated Firmware and Software
Outdated firmware and software can leave your WiFi router vulnerable to hacking. Manufacturers regularly release updates to patch security vulnerabilities, but if you don’t install these updates, your router remains exposed.
Firmware Updates
Firmware updates often include security patches that fix known vulnerabilities. Failing to install these updates can leave your router open to attack.
Software Updates
Similarly, software updates can also include security patches and new features that enhance your router’s security. Keeping your router’s software up-to-date is crucial to preventing hacking.
WPS Vulnerability
The WiFi Protected Setup (WPS) feature is designed to make it easy to connect devices to your network. However, it can also be a vulnerability. Hackers can exploit the WPS feature to gain access to your router and network.
WPS Pin
The WPS pin is an 8-digit code that allows devices to connect to your network. However, hackers can use specialized software to crack the WPS pin, gaining access to your router.
Consequences of a Hacked WiFi Router
If a hacker gains access to your WiFi router, the consequences can be severe. Here are some potential risks:
Data Theft and Eavesdropping
Hackers can intercept sensitive data, such as passwords, credit card numbers, and personal information, as it’s transmitted over your network.
Malware and Virus Distribution
Hackers can use your router to distribute malware and viruses to devices connected to your network, compromising their security and potentially causing damage.
DDoS Attacks and Network Disruption
Hackers can use your router to launch Distributed Denial-of-Service (DDoS) attacks, overwhelming your network with traffic and causing disruptions.
Unwanted Changes and Configuration
Hackers can make unwanted changes to your router’s configuration, such as changing the DNS settings or redirecting traffic to malicious websites.
Protecting Your WiFi Router from Hacking
While the risks associated with WiFi router hacking are real, there are steps you can take to protect your network. Here are some practical tips to safeguard your WiFi router:
Change the Default Admin Password
Change the default admin password to a strong, unique one to prevent unauthorized access. Use a password manager to generate and store complex passwords.
Enable WPA2 Encryption
Enable WPA2 encryption to secure your network and protect data transmission. WPA2 is the latest encryption standard, and it’s essential to use it to prevent hacking.
Disable WPS
Disable the WPS feature to prevent hackers from exploiting it. While WPS can make it easy to connect devices, the risks associated with it outweigh the benefits.
Keep Firmware and Software Up-to-Date
Regularly update your router’s firmware and software to ensure you have the latest security patches and features.
Use a Firewall
Enable the firewall on your router to block unauthorized access and protect your network from hacking.
Use a VPN
Consider using a Virtual Private Network (VPN) to encrypt your internet traffic and protect your data transmission.
Monitor Your Network
Regularly monitor your network for suspicious activity, such as unknown devices or unusual traffic patterns.
Best Practices for WiFi Router Security
In addition to the tips mentioned above, here are some best practices for WiFi router security:
Use a Guest Network
Use a guest network to isolate visitors from your main network, preventing them from accessing sensitive data.
Limit Network Access
Limit network access to only those devices that need it, reducing the attack surface and preventing unauthorized access.
Use MAC Address Filtering
Use MAC address filtering to control which devices can connect to your network, preventing unknown devices from accessing your network.
Regularly Back Up Your Router’s Configuration
Regularly back up your router’s configuration to prevent data loss in case your router is compromised or needs to be reset.

What are the risks of someone getting into my WiFi router?
When someone gains unauthorized access to your WiFi router, they can pose significant risks to your network and personal data. One of the primary risks is that they can intercept and steal sensitive information, such as passwords, credit card numbers, and other confidential data. This can be done by setting up a man-in-the-middle (MITM) attack, where the hacker intercepts communication between your devices and the internet.
Additionally, an unauthorized user can also use your network to conduct malicious activities, such as hacking into other networks, distributing malware, or engaging in denial-of-service (DoS) attacks. They can also change your router’s settings, such as the WiFi password, network name, and DNS settings, which can cause disruptions to your internet connection and compromise your network’s security.
How can someone get into my WiFi router?
There are several ways someone can gain unauthorized access to your WiFi router. One common method is by guessing or cracking the router’s admin password. Many people use default or weak passwords, which can be easily guessed or cracked using specialized software. Another method is by exploiting vulnerabilities in the router’s firmware or software.
Additionally, someone can also gain access to your router by using social engineering tactics, such as phishing or pretexting, to trick you into revealing your admin password. They can also use malware or viruses to infect your devices and gain access to your router. It’s essential to take proactive measures to secure your router and protect your network from these types of threats.
What are the signs that someone has accessed my WiFi router?
If someone has accessed your WiFi router, there are several signs you can look out for. One common sign is unusual network activity, such as unfamiliar devices connected to your network or strange login locations. You may also notice changes to your router’s settings, such as a changed WiFi password or network name.
Another sign is slow internet speeds or intermittent connectivity issues. This can be caused by an unauthorized user consuming bandwidth or disrupting your network’s performance. You may also notice strange pop-ups or ads on your devices, which can be a sign of malware or viruses. If you suspect someone has accessed your router, it’s essential to take immediate action to secure your network.

What is WPA2 encryption, and why is it important?
WPA2 (WiFi Protected Access 2) is a security protocol that encrypts data transmitted between your devices and your WiFi router. It’s essential to enable WPA2 encryption to protect your data from interception and eavesdropping. WPA2 encryption uses a strong encryption algorithm to scramble your data, making it unreadable to unauthorized users.
WPA2 encryption is important because it provides a secure connection between your devices and your router. Without WPA2 encryption, your data can be easily intercepted and stolen by hackers. It’s essential to use WPA2 encryption, especially when transmitting sensitive information, such as passwords, credit card numbers, or confidential data.
How can I update my WiFi router’s firmware?
Updating your WiFi router’s firmware is a crucial step in maintaining your network’s security. To update your router’s firmware, you’ll typically need to access the router’s web-based interface using a web browser. You’ll need to log in to the router using your admin password and navigate to the firmware update section.
Once you’ve located the firmware update section, you can check for updates and download the latest firmware version. Follow the on-screen instructions to install the update, and your router will restart with the new firmware. It’s essential to regularly check for firmware updates to ensure you have the latest security patches and features.
What should I do if I suspect someone has accessed my WiFi router?
If you suspect someone has accessed your WiFi router, it’s essential to take immediate action to secure your network. The first step is to change your admin password and WiFi password to prevent further unauthorized access. You should also update your router’s firmware and software to ensure you have the latest security patches.
Additionally, you should scan your devices for malware and viruses and run a network scan to detect any suspicious activity. You may also want to consider resetting your router to its factory settings and reconfiguring your network settings. If you’re unsure about how to secure your network, consider consulting with a cybersecurity expert or contacting your internet service provider for assistance.
